Transaction 63b328d6b30f9526eb953b739af6b3cf8418d7636eb7e85ea4931ed770775ca6

1 Input
2 Outputs
  • 63b328d6b30f9526eb953b739af6b3cf8418d7636eb7e85ea4931ed770775ca6:0
  • value  10000000
    address  1MrAHVDNVqJs1W21LdGW6x4NpQHMufuZpE
  • 63b328d6b30f9526eb953b739af6b3cf8418d7636eb7e85ea4931ed770775ca6:1
  • value  76644
    address  1EBw2AVzqS2uqxWRFPXuZXKtshmfhsP5MS